Why Electricity Billing Differs Between Rural and Urban Areas
The electricity bill comparison Pakistan isn’t just about numbers—it reflects decades of policy decisions, infrastructure development, and socio-economic inequality. Here’s why these variations are so stark:
Infrastructure Disparity
Urban areas typically have better-maintained power grids, reducing transmission losses. In contrast, rural regions deal with outdated lines and transformers, often leading to higher per-unit costs due to losses.
NEPRA Rates Pakistan & Tariff Structures
The NEPRA rates Pakistan vary for different consumer categories. Urban consumers may fall into higher slabs due to increased usage, while rural areas might benefit from agricultural subsidies—but these come with limitations.
Rural Power Supply Challenges
The rural billing system Pakistan is plagued by frequent load shedding, voltage drops, and delayed meter readings. These inconsistencies often lead to estimated billing, increasing costs unfairly.
Policy Focus
Investment in energy infrastructure is more city-centric. This leaves rural setups under-resourced, contributing to higher service delivery costs and discrepancies in consumer bills.

Methodology of Our Bill Comparison
To ensure a transparent and factual approach, we conducted an extensive electricity bill survey Pakistan using the following method:
- Sample Size: 1,200 households
- Provinces Covered: Punjab, Sindh, Khyber Pakhtunkhwa, and Balochistan
- Timeframe: October 2024 – March 2025
- Metrics Compared: Monthly units consumed, per-unit tariff, taxes/surcharges, supply reliability
This structured utility bill study 2025 helped us compare electric consumption rural vs urban on a fair scale. The aim was to identify not just price differences, but the root causes behind them.
Key Findings – Rural vs Urban Electricity Bills
Below is a quick comparison to illustrate how rural electricity rates Pakistan stack up against urban ones:
Rural Areas | Urban Areas |
Avg. units/month: 250 | Avg. units/month: 450 |
Tariff: Rs. 16/unit | Tariff: Rs. 18.5/unit |
Load Shedding: 10–12 hrs/day | Load Shedding: 2–4 hrs/day |
Government Subsidies: Partial for agriculture | Government Subsidies: Minimal |
Meter Reading: Often estimated | Meter Reading: Mostly automated |
Complaint Response Time: 5–7 days | Complaint Response Time: 1–2 days |
From the above, it’s evident that while urban electricity usage is higher, the reliability of service often offsets the slightly higher costs. In contrast, rural electricity rates Pakistan can seem lower on paper but lead to frustrations due to service gaps.
Surprising Insights We Discovered
1. Higher Bills Despite Lower Usage in Rural Areas
Even with fewer appliances, some rural users reported bills equal to or higher than urban consumers. Faulty meters and flat-rate billing are primary culprits—a shocking result from our electricity cost insights Pakistan.
2. Hidden Costs of Unreliable Supply
In rural regions, many households resort to generators or UPS systems. This off-grid power generation significantly increases their monthly spending on energy.
3. Energy Inequality Across Provinces
There is clear energy inequality between urbanized cities and rural regions, especially in Balochistan and interior Sindh, where electricity remains both expensive and unreliable. 4. Lack of Consumer Awareness
In both rural and urban samples, we found a disturbing lack of consumer awareness regarding tariff slabs, peak hour consumption, and bill components—widening the gap in understanding and optimizing usage.

Switch to Smart Appliances
For those wondering how to reduce electricity bill in Pakistan, start with energy-efficient fans, LED bulbs, and inverter-based systems.
Track and Analyze Bills Monthly
Use apps or platforms to check your utility bill. Spotting unusual spikes helps you act early.
Shift to Off-Peak Hours
Practicing smart electricity usage by running heavy appliances like washing machines and irons during off-peak hours can reduce unit charges.
Educate Rural Households on Efficient Use
Community-level workshops focusing on saving tips for rural households can reduce unnecessary wastage, especially where awareness is low.
